California election limbo fueled by 4 pressure points dragging out vote count, expert says
RSS SUMMARY · AGGREGATED FROM FOX NEWS
Election law expert Hans von Spakovsky says California's slow vote counting stems from mass mail voting, a seven-day ballot window, and cure periods.
